Transaction 86093384ef2b5e0163ff4c646365a15441ad43a8b5744ab9ac542decca2e1311
1 Input
1 Output
-
86093384ef2b5e0163ff4c646365a15441ad43a8b5744ab9ac542decca2e1311:0
- value
- 544846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00b14a4706a13f81b7ec4bb37eca9dc03ae4150e OP_EQUAL
- address
- 31kgJswT4Qb6Gmk2kDu4p3dYNdhAq2iYtc